The World Health Organization has upped the red flag for the swine flu to level five and the country is under alert. Just before news time, the Ministry of Health issued a directive to call off all major public events planned for this long weekend in the face of the rising threat of a pandemic. […]

The illegal clearing at Victoria Peak has had residents up in arms since it first came to light last Thursday. The unique and pristine vegetation was destroyed in an area covering ten by fifteen feet at the summit of the national monument to accommodate the landing of a BATSUB helicopter on April eight.
